Understanding SMTP Protocols for Efficient Mail Delivery
SMTP, Simple Mail Transfer Protocol, plays a pivotal role in ensuring swift mail delivery across the internet. This set of rules outlines the format for electronic messages, guiding their transmission from sender to recipient. A thorough understanding of SMTP protocols empowers individuals and organizations to enhance their email systems for greater reliability.
Let's a glimpse at some key aspects of SMTP:
- Requests: These are the messages sent by the sending mail server to the receiving mail server. Examples include HELO, MAIL FROM, RCPT TO, DATA, each with a specific role.
- Content Transmission: SMTP dictates how email content is formatted and sent between servers. This includes the use of line breaks, codepages, and other standards.
- Error Handling: SMTP defines a system of responses to indicate success during the email delivery procedure. Understanding these codes can be invaluable for identifying delivery issues.
Proper setup of SMTP protocols is crucial for achieving a seamless and dependable email journey.
Best Practices for Secure SMTP Server Configuration
Securing your SMTP environment is paramount to protecting against malicious attacks. Implement robust access control mechanisms like SPF, DKIM, and DMARC to validate email sender. Regularly patch your SMTP server software with the latest security updates to mitigate known vulnerabilities. Employ complex passwords and enforce multi-factor verification for administrative access. Implement intrusion detection system rules to restrict incoming connections to your SMTP server, accepting only trusted IP addresses or ranges.
Maintain detailed transaction history to track all SMTP server activity and identify any suspicious behavior. Conduct regular security reviews to analyze your SMTP server configuration and identify potential weaknesses.
Troubleshooting Common SMTP Errors and Issues
When transmitting emails via Simple Mail Transfer Protocol (SMTP), you may occasionally encounter different problems. These occurrences can be annoying, but understanding common SMTP defects and their reasons can help you resolve them effectively.
A frequently encountered problem is a "550 User Not Found" message, indicating the intended recipient's email address is invalid or doesn't exist. Another common indication is a "421 Server Not Available" message, which suggests the SMTP server is currently unresponsive.
To avoid these and other SMTP challenges, it's crucial to:
* Confirm your email address and recipient address are correctly formatted.
* Examine the status of the SMTP server you're attempting to connect to.
* Scrutinize your email client's parameters for any potential errors.
* Seek guidance from online resources or technical support if you're stuck.
By following these recommendations, you can effectively diagnose common SMTP problems and ensure your emails are transmitted successfully.
